Why Choose Dental Implants in Brandon, FL?

The benefits of opting for dental implants are numerous and far-reaching:

 

  1. Improved Appearance and Confidence: Dental implants seamlessly blend with your natural teeth, providing a confident smile and boosting your overall self-esteem.
  2. Enhanced Speech and Eating: Unlike dentures, dental implants stay firmly in place, ensuring clear speech and the ability to eat any food you desire.
  3. Comfort and Convenience: Say goodbye to the embarrassment of removable dentures and the need for messy adhesives to hold them in place.
  4. Enhanced Oral and Systemic Health: Dental implants don’t rely on neighboring teeth for support, as traditional tooth-supported bridges do. This preserves the integrity of your original teeth and promotes long-term oral and systemic health.
  5. Durability: With proper care, dental implants can last a lifetime, providing a long-term solution for tooth loss.
  6. Prevents Bone Loss and Protects Existing Teeth: By replacing the missing tooth’s root with an implant, the jawbone continues to receive stimulation, preventing bone loss and the shifting of remaining teeth.

What is a Dental Implant?

Dental implants are cutting-edge tooth replacement options that resemble natural teeth in both look and function. They consist of titanium rods surgically inserted into your jaw, serving as artificial roots for replacement teeth.

 

The advantages of dental implants over crowns, bridges, and dentures are clear. They have become the gold standard for tooth replacement due to their natural look and functionality.

Am I a Candidate for Dental Implants?

To be a candidate for dental implants, you need sufficient bone in your jaw to support the implant. If additional bone is required, bone grafting can supplement the necessary support. Dental implants can replace a single tooth, multiple missing teeth, or an entire arch of teeth.

The dental implant surgical procedure typically involves three main stages:

  1. Titanium Implant Rod Placement: This rod is inserted into the bone socket where the tooth is missing.
  2. Abutment Attachment: An abutment is attached to the implant rod to provide a base for the new crown.
  3. Custom Crown: A natural-looking, custom-made crown is designed to match your other teeth seamlessly.

The implant placement procedure is conducted with minimal discomfort, thanks to local anesthesia or IV sedation administered by your dentist in Brandon, FL, Dr. John Cherry. A small incision is made in the gums to place the tooth root implant into the jawbone, followed by closing the gums over the implant for healing.

The essential process of osseointegration begins when your bone bonds with the rod, creating a solid anchor for your new teeth. This healing process typically takes two to six months, allowing time for the implant to integrate with the jawbone fully.

Dr. John Cherry will determine when it’s time to move forward. In cases where more time is needed, a temporary crown may be attached to allow you to eat and speak normally while you wait for the final restoration.

Once the implant has fused with the jawbone, the abutment is attached to the implant post, serving as the foundation for the new crown. The crown is custom-crafted to match your natural teeth for a seamless, natural look, making it difficult for friends and family to detect that you’ve had dental work done.
